On the last Failure of Kosciusko

O What a loud and fearful shriek was there,
As though a thousand souls one death-groan poured!
Ah me! they saw beneath a hireling’s sword
Their Kosciusko fall! Through the swart air

(As pauses the tired Cossack’s barbarous yell
Of triumpf) on the chill and midnight gale
Rises with frantic burst, or sadder swell,
The dirge of murdered Hope! while Freedom pale

Bends in such anguish o’er her destined bier,
As if from eldest time some Spirit meek
Had gathered in a mystic urn each tear
That ever on a patriot’s furrowed cheek

Fit channel found; and she had drained the bowl
In the mere wilfulness and sick despair of soul!
